Lion Steel Stores Inc.(LSI) is a golfing equipment and supplies store. The fiscal year-end is July 31.

•All counters must print their name and sign each sheet that they use.
•The sheets are already marked for each shelf in the warehouse. Make sure to only record inventory on the proper inventory sheet for that shelf. For example, do not record inventory from shelf 31-A on a sheet marked as 31-B, and so on.
•A number of items will be on the storeroom floor marked for customers to try as demonstration goods. Do not count items marked as "demo" or "display".
•Everyone must take their lunch break and morning break at the same time during the count.
•Turn in all count sheets, including sheets that are not used.
•Record the inventory part number, the quantity, and note any indications of damage on the count sheet.
•If an item looks obsolete, estimate the new value and enter that on the count sheet.
•The count will start at 8:00 a.m. Everyone must be in attendance at 7:00 a.m. to review the count instructions.
•The shop supervisors will be available in the warehouse if you encounter any problems and to collect completed count sheets. Empty sheets are to be turned in when you have completed your area.
•Try to count everything quickly. If a sales clerk wants to remove an item for sale to a customer, be sure to count it first.
Required
Identify three strengths in the inventory count procedures at LSI [1 mark each], and explain why each is a strength [1 mark each].
